Eplan offers an AI solution for electrical design

Eplan Copilot is Eplan’s first AI solution. It is integrated into the Eplan Platform and acts as a connecting element between the individual systems.

It enables users to formulate tasks in natural language and thus operate the software intuitively. This means you no longer need to be familiar with every function – the AI simply makes them accessible.

“We want to give users the best possible support in using and mastering our software for their tasks,” says Sebastian Seitz, CEO at Eplan.

eplan copilot ai solution
Based on a described task, Eplan Copilot generates: 
  • Context-sensitive answers 
  • Clear recommendations for action 
  • Step-by-step instructions 
  • And – in the future – automated actions

Stories with our partners

Working together towards “Connected Industry”

A use case developed using the Microsoft Azure OpenAI Service demonstrates how artificial intelligence can support engineering in the future. It shows how an assembly panel layout can eventually be generated fully automatically by AI.

This includes selecting the appropriate enclosure or mounting plate, as well as cable ducts, DIN rails and components. At the touch of a button, the AI generates the appropriate layout, and the user immediately knows which enclosure is suitable for which project.

Our experts see potential time savings of up to 40 per cent here. This is a potential area of application that is currently still in the conceptual phase – a conceivable direction, but one that does not necessarily lead to product maturity. 

Copilot end-to-end integration with Siemens

Together with our partner Siemens, we are presenting our latest developments in the use of generative AI-supported copilots in engineering. The aim of the collaboration is comprehensive end-to-end integration that will digitise and automate the entire engineering process in future.

The Siemens Engineering Copilot already enables the automatic generation of TIA code blocks for programmable logic controllers. In a showcase, we also demonstrate how the Industrial Copilot can independently make changes to an Eplan project – and that is just the beginning.

 “In future, industrial copilots will work ever more autonomously and be even more closely networked with other systems,” says Rainer Brehm, COO for the automation business and CTO at Siemens Digital Industries. “This will revolutionise engineering and give companies an enormous competitive advantage.”
